Hello from Hazard!

We heard from four more readers who knew Item No. 884, which we revealed last week, was a Schrader tire pressure gauge.

Thanks go out to: Gerald Payne, Cortland, Ohio; Dan Hilterbrand, West Liberty, Ohio; Howard Baker, Cortland, Ohio; and Joe Michalek, of Bedford, Ohio, who also writes that the Schrader Company would put any tire company or hardware store name on the unit.

The gauge we showed was marked “pat’d Mar 28 1916″, so it was definitely an oldie.

This week, we show Item No. 885 again. It was part of an exhibit Dennis Hevener had at Oglebay Park’s Fort Henry Days last year.

Anyone know how this trowel-looking thing was used?
